Uses of Class
com.azure.search.documents.indexes.models.SearchAlias
Packages that use SearchAlias
Package
Description
Azure AI Search, formerly known as "Azure AI Search", provides secure information retrieval at scale over
user-owned content in traditional and conversational search applications.
Package containing the data models for SearchServiceClient.
-
Uses of SearchAlias in com.azure.search.documents.indexes
Methods in com.azure.search.documents.indexes that return SearchAliasModifier and TypeMethodDescriptionSearchIndexClient.createAlias(SearchAlias alias) Creates a new Azure AI Search alias.SearchIndexClient.createOrUpdateAlias(SearchAlias alias) Creates or updates an Azure AI Search alias.Gets the Azure AI Search alias.Methods in com.azure.search.documents.indexes that return types with arguments of type SearchAliasModifier and TypeMethodDescriptionSearchIndexAsyncClient.createAlias(SearchAlias alias) Creates a new Azure AI Search alias.Mono<com.azure.core.http.rest.Response<SearchAlias>> SearchIndexAsyncClient.createAliasWithResponse(SearchAlias alias) Creates a new Azure AI Search alias.com.azure.core.http.rest.Response<SearchAlias> SearchIndexClient.createAliasWithResponse(SearchAlias alias, com.azure.core.util.Context context) Creates a new Azure AI Search alias.SearchIndexAsyncClient.createOrUpdateAlias(SearchAlias alias) Creates or updates an Azure AI Search alias.Mono<com.azure.core.http.rest.Response<SearchAlias>> SearchIndexAsyncClient.createOrUpdateAliasWithResponse(SearchAlias alias, boolean onlyIfUnchanged) Creates or updates an Azure AI Search alias.com.azure.core.http.rest.Response<SearchAlias> SearchIndexClient.createOrUpdateAliasWithResponse(SearchAlias alias, boolean onlyIfUnchanged, com.azure.core.util.Context context) Creates or updates an Azure AI Search alias.Gets the Azure AI Search alias.Mono<com.azure.core.http.rest.Response<SearchAlias>> SearchIndexAsyncClient.getAliasWithResponse(String aliasName) Gets the Azure AI Search alias.com.azure.core.http.rest.Response<SearchAlias> SearchIndexClient.getAliasWithResponse(String aliasName, com.azure.core.util.Context context) Gets the Azure AI Search alias.com.azure.core.http.rest.PagedFlux<SearchAlias> SearchIndexAsyncClient.listAliases()Lists all aliases in the Azure AI Search service.com.azure.core.http.rest.PagedIterable<SearchAlias> SearchIndexClient.listAliases()Lists all aliases in the Azure AI Search service.com.azure.core.http.rest.PagedIterable<SearchAlias> SearchIndexClient.listAliases(com.azure.core.util.Context context) Lists all aliases in the Azure AI Search service.Methods in com.azure.search.documents.indexes with parameters of type SearchAliasModifier and TypeMethodDescriptionSearchIndexAsyncClient.createAlias(SearchAlias alias) Creates a new Azure AI Search alias.SearchIndexClient.createAlias(SearchAlias alias) Creates a new Azure AI Search alias.Mono<com.azure.core.http.rest.Response<SearchAlias>> SearchIndexAsyncClient.createAliasWithResponse(SearchAlias alias) Creates a new Azure AI Search alias.com.azure.core.http.rest.Response<SearchAlias> SearchIndexClient.createAliasWithResponse(SearchAlias alias, com.azure.core.util.Context context) Creates a new Azure AI Search alias.SearchIndexAsyncClient.createOrUpdateAlias(SearchAlias alias) Creates or updates an Azure AI Search alias.SearchIndexClient.createOrUpdateAlias(SearchAlias alias) Creates or updates an Azure AI Search alias.Mono<com.azure.core.http.rest.Response<SearchAlias>> SearchIndexAsyncClient.createOrUpdateAliasWithResponse(SearchAlias alias, boolean onlyIfUnchanged) Creates or updates an Azure AI Search alias.com.azure.core.http.rest.Response<SearchAlias> SearchIndexClient.createOrUpdateAliasWithResponse(SearchAlias alias, boolean onlyIfUnchanged, com.azure.core.util.Context context) Creates or updates an Azure AI Search alias.SearchIndexAsyncClient.deleteAliasWithResponse(SearchAlias alias, boolean onlyIfUnchanged) Deletes the Azure AI Search alias.com.azure.core.http.rest.Response<Void> SearchIndexClient.deleteAliasWithResponse(SearchAlias alias, boolean onlyIfUnchanged, com.azure.core.util.Context context) Deletes the Azure AI Search alias. -
Uses of SearchAlias in com.azure.search.documents.indexes.models
Classes in com.azure.search.documents.indexes.models that implement interfaces with type arguments of type SearchAliasModifier and TypeClassDescriptionfinal classRepresents an index alias, which describes a mapping from the alias name to an index.Methods in com.azure.search.documents.indexes.models that return SearchAliasModifier and TypeMethodDescriptionstatic SearchAliasSearchAlias.fromJson(com.azure.json.JsonReader jsonReader) Reads an instance of SearchAlias from the JsonReader.Set the eTag property: The ETag of the alias.